# An In-Depth Resource on Key Tools for Fixing Instrument Clusters on Motorbikes

Motorbike aficionados frequently encounter the task of mending or substituting instrument clusters. These essential parts not only deliver vital data regarding speed, fuel levels, and engine temperature, but they also enhance the bike’s overall visual appeal. Whether you’re an experienced mechanic or a beginner tackling DIY projects, possessing the appropriate tools is crucial for a successful fix. This resource highlights the key tools required for repairing instrument clusters on motorbikes, alongside useful tips for efficient usage.

## Grasping the Instrument Cluster

Before delving into the necessary tools for repairs, it’s essential to comprehend what an instrument cluster is and its elements. The instrument cluster generally comprises:

– **Speedometer**: Gauges the motorcycle’s speed.
– **Tachometer**: Shows engine RPM (revolutions per minute).
– **Fuel Gauge**: Reflects the fuel quantity in the tank.
– **Temperature Gauge**: Observes the engine temperature.
– **Warning Lights**: Notifies the rider of issues such as low oil pressure or battery malfunctions.

## Key Tools for Fixing Instrument Clusters

### 1. **Screwdrivers**

A comprehensive set of screwdrivers is indispensable for any repair task. You’ll require both flathead and Phillips screwdrivers in multiple sizes to detach screws from the instrument cluster cover and reach internal components.

### 2. **Socket Set**

A socket set is vital for loosening and securing bolts that anchor the instrument cluster. Ensure you choose a set that includes both metric and standard sizes, as motorbike manufacturers may opt for either.

### 3. **Pliers**

Pliers, including needle-nose and standard types, are essential for gripping, twisting, and severing wires. They also aid in the extraction of stubborn connectors and clips.

### 4. **Wire Strippers and Crimpers**

Should you need to repair or substitute wiring within the instrument cluster, wire strippers and crimpers are critical. These tools enable you to strip insulation from wires and securely attach connectors.

### 5. **Multimeter**

A multimeter is a crucial device for diagnosing electrical problems. It can assess voltage, current, and resistance, assisting you in pinpointing issues within the instrument cluster’s electrical framework.

### 6. **Soldering Iron and Solder**

For enduring repairs, particularly when addressing broken connections or impaired circuits, a soldering iron and solder are essential. This enables you to establish robust, reliable connections that can endure vibration and heat.

### 7. **Heat Shrink Tubing**

After soldering wires, implementing heat shrink tubing can offer extra insulation and safeguarding against moisture and wear. This is particularly vital in a motorcycle setting, where exposure to the elements is commonplace.

### 8. **Cleaning Supplies**

Maintaining cleanliness in the instrument cluster is crucial for functionality and appearance. Utilize isopropyl alcohol, soft cloths, and brushes to cleanse the lenses and internal components without inflicting damage.

### 9. **Replacement Parts**

Having a variety of replacement components readily available can expedite repairs. This might entail bulbs, fuses, connectors, and even entire gauge assemblies, contingent on the specific issues faced.

### 10. **Service Manual**

A service manual tailored to your motorcycle model is an invaluable tool. It offers detailed diagrams, wiring schematics, and step-by-step guidance for disassembling and mending the instrument cluster.

## Recommendations for Fixing Instrument Clusters

1. **Operate in a Well-Lit Space**: Adequate lighting is vital for viewing minute components and reading fine details on circuit boards.

2. **Systematize Your Workspace**: Maintain organization among your tools and parts to prevent the loss of minor screws or elements during the repair procedure.

3. **Capture Photos**: Prior to disassembling the instrument cluster, document the wiring and assembly through photographs. This will assist in recalling the correct reassembly order.

4. **Conduct Tests After Repair**: Once the repair is finalized, examine the instrument cluster prior to reassembling the entire bike. This confirms that everything operates accurately.

5. **Seek Professional Aid When Necessary**: If you encounter complicated issues or feel uncertain about a repair, don’t hesitate to consult a professional mechanic. Some repairs may necessitate specialized tools or expertise.
